About
I’m an AI Engineering Manager at Marex, building production machine learning and LLM systems for financial markets.
I hold a PhD in Applied Mathematics from the University of Manchester (supervised by Prof. Nicholas Higham) and spent time as a visiting researcher at MIT CSAIL, working on numerical linear algebra and time-dependent networks.
